This typeface is an oblique sans with a clean, geometric construction and smooth, rounded curves. Strokes are even and steady, with minimal contrast and crisp terminals that read as decisively cut rather than calligraphic. Counters are generally open and spacious, and the overall rhythm feels consistent and controlled. The forms lean forward with a clear slant, while round letters stay close to circular and straight strokes remain taut, producing a tidy, contemporary texture in text.
It works well for interface labels, product branding, and short-to-medium headlines where a modern italic voice is desirable. The clear shapes and open counters also make it suitable for promotional copy, posters, and dynamic brand systems that want motion without looking decorative.
The forward slant gives the face an energetic, on-the-move tone, while the restrained geometry keeps it precise and professional. It feels contemporary and efficient rather than expressive, with a friendly approachability coming from the rounded bowls and open apertures. Overall, it conveys a modern, functional voice suitable for confident, straightforward messaging.
The design appears intended as a contemporary oblique companion for a geometric sans, emphasizing clarity, speed, and a sleek, modern presence. Its uniform stroke and rounded construction suggest a focus on versatile, everyday readability with a subtle sense of momentum.
In the sample text, spacing appears comfortable and even, helping the italic texture remain legible across longer lines. Numerals and capitals follow the same streamlined, geometric logic, supporting a cohesive look across mixed-case settings.
